The members of your wedding party have shown up on time and smiling to each wedding event you've planned. They've bought expensive dresses or rented tuxes, organized bachelor and bachelorette parties, or helped calm you down when the stress of planning was overwhelming. Thank your closest friends for all they've done by passing out thoughtful gifts. It's customary for the bride and groom to give gifts to the bridal party during the rehearsal dinner or some other quiet moment before the wedding.

  1. For the Wedding

    • Since the couple generally presents these gifts before the wedding day, you can give out gifts that your bridesmaids and groomsmen can use during the big day. The women may like new makeup kits they can use to primp before the ceremony. You might also choose jewelry or purses that matches their dresses. These gifts should be neutral enough they can use them again with different outfits. Buy tie pins or silk handkerchiefs for the guys. If your budget allows, pick up new digital cameras so your bridal party can capture the best moments of the big day.

    Experiences

    • Being in a wedding can get expensive, so your friends may be counting their pennies after the wedding. Pick up gift certificates so your bridal party can treat themselves after the big day. For the bridesmaids, choose certificates to a spa or nail salon. Treat the men to a round of golf or a season's pass to the batting cages. A gift card to a local restaurant or bar or tickets to a concert or sporting event are also thoughtful ideas.

    Party

    • Organize a "thank you" party for your wedding party to enjoy once the stress of the wedding is over. Throw a party at your home or a restaurant about a month after the wedding. Ask a friend to play bartender and order plenty of junk food. Choose a casual theme for the party, like karaoke or a luau. Create invitations to present to your bridal party before the wedding. Wrap the invitations up with party hats, miniature bottles of liquor and Silly String to show that this will be a fun, relaxing event.

    Personalized Gifts

    • Presenting your bridal party with engraved gifts will make each person feel special and appreciated. For the women, get silver picture frames engraved with the wedding date and a personal message from the bride. Groomsmen may appreciate a silver flask engraved with their initials. For a more casual and fun personalized gift, give ice buckets engraved with the initials of each wedding party member. Fill the buckets with DVDs, junk food and bottles of wine for your friends to kick back with once the wedding is over.
